GSA's Premier GWAC

Alliant, the U.S. General Services Administration's (GSA) premier government-wide acquisition contract (GWAC), provides Federal agencies with a centralized source for acquiring integrated information technology (IT) solutions worldwide. Alliant is a ten year (five year base with one five year option) Multiple Award/Indefinite-Delivery, Indefinite Quantity (MA/IDIQ) contract, offering a cost effective and streamlined procurement process, as well as access to pre-qualified IT service providers.

Features

  • 10 year Multiple Award/Indefinite-Delivery, Indefinite-Quantity (MA/IDIQ) (Five year base, one five year option)
  • $50 Billion contract ceiling
  • North American Industry Classification System (NAICS):
    • 541512, Computer Systems Design Services
  • Supports various task order contract types:
    • Fixed Price (FPI, FPAF)
    • Cost (CPFF, CPIF, CPAF)
    • Time & Material and Labor Hour
  • For use by federal and Department of Defense agencies with a delegation of procurement authority
  • Ability to support regional and global IT requirements
  • Increased small business subcontracting goals
  • Allows for ancillary support to offer an integrated IT solution
  • Task order ordering guide
